Output 2689becac8ad05999772fa3eb547af431f2cd01eee4fa4516fa8043e9b699b4e:0
- value
- 708193
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de7efb959aae8db15e233431714056e0bcaf7a20 OP_EQUAL
- address
- 3MyU43eCvMpcRT6tZmhKVboUHyUhePfent
- transaction
- 2689becac8ad05999772fa3eb547af431f2cd01eee4fa4516fa8043e9b699b4e
- confirmations
- 146512
- spent
- true